import itertools def gcd(a,b): if b==0: return a else: return gcd(b,a%b) string = input() A=[i for i in string] B=[] for i in itertools.permutations(A): B.append((int("".join(i)))) res=B[0] for i in range(1,len(B)): res=gcd(B[i],res) print(res)